About Moorefield, AR
Moorefield is a small community in Arkansas with a population of 115 residents. The median household income is $65,833 per year, which is near the national average. The median age in Moorefield is 48.8 years.
Housing in Moorefield has a median home value of $200,000 and median monthly rent of $1,071. Of the 70 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 46 owner-occupied and 16 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Moorefield is 7.8% and the poverty rate is 9.6%. 49.0%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 18.2 minutes.

Cost of Living in Moorefield, AR
Compared to national averages, Moorefield has a median household income of $65,833 (12% below the national median of $75,149). Home values average $200,000, which is 18% below the national median. Monthly rent at $1,071 is 8% below the US average of $1,163. Within Arkansas, Moorefield's income is 26% above the state average of $52,241, and home values are 59% above the state median of $125,457.
